Output 516f56e5ebdc10cd8d3dac078d26ee4edbdbd37e37425c30657898077c72215f:0

value
58000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78b656f2a4b8f7446d9a89c2c02f0fa356891983 OP_EQUALVERIFY OP_CHECKSIG
address
1C1GXCbbaPoMP74R9CRVpuJ9ytTkb88d43
transaction
516f56e5ebdc10cd8d3dac078d26ee4edbdbd37e37425c30657898077c72215f
spent
true